Exhibition catalogue. 9 plates well printed in original colours of sepia, ochres and b/w by De Meyer, White, Stieglitz, Strand and Weston. Informative text considers the changes in aesthetics from pictorialism to modernism, from 1898 to 1945, through the images of these photographers who shaped the course of modern photography.
Target II: 5 American Photographers is a publication by Anne Tucker for The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ston. Released in 1981, the book serves as a companion to an exhibition showcasing the works of five distinct American photographers. It provides a curated look at contemporary American photography within the context of the museum's collection and programming.
